This engraving, titled "St John the Baptist preaching in the desert" transports us back to 16th century Germany during the Renaissance period. Created by Albrecht Durer or Duerer, a renowned German artist of that time, this print showcases his exceptional talent and attention to detail. The scene depicts St John the Baptist passionately delivering his sermon in the barren wilderness. The preacher's expressive gestures and intense gaze captivate his audience, who are depicted as devoutly listening to his words. The vastness of the desert serves as a metaphor for spiritual solitude and reflection. Durer's mastery is evident in every line and stroke of this artwork. His intricate engravings bring life to each figure present, showcasing their individuality and emotions. This particular print was created as an illustration for Paul Lacroix's book "Les Arts au Moyen Age" (Arts in the Middle Ages), published by Firmin Didot in 1869. As we admire this piece, we are reminded of its historical significance within German culture and European Christianity. It symbolizes not only religious devotion but also highlights Durer's contribution to art during this transformative era.
